A stipulated judgment is a judgment which both sides agree to have entered. If the agreement is not followed, the plaintiff can file an affidavit of default wherein the judgment can be entered without notice to the defendant(s). This default judgment is binding and failure to comply with it means that an enforcement action could be taken. Enforcement actions vary, but can include wage garnishment and/or property lien(s).
Also referred to as an agreed judgment.
